AN AEROACOUSTIC MODEL ABOUT THE ROTATING STALL OF A COMPRESSOR

Abstract: Some experiments show that a kind of special acoustic phenomenon, quite different from that of a normal conditiou of a compreeor, will appear on a compressor test in rotating stall condition. However, little has been known about these problems until now.An aeroacoustic model about the rotating stall of a compressor is described in this paper. The acoustic nature of rotating stall can be preliminarily explained according to this model. Based on the analysis of the nature of frequency and propagation of the sound from rotating stall, an acoustic measuring method for characteristic parameters, such as the number and propagation speed of stall cell, can be obtained. Compared with existing methods, it is an untouched measure without disturbing the flow. The initial experiment results obtained from a transonic axial compressor facility show that this method is feasible. The sound pressure produced by rotating stall is numerically analyed with the change of the width of stall zone, the number and propagation speed of stall cell.
